About Remraam and Dubai Properties

Remraam is a gated, master-planned apartment community by Dubai Properties in Dubailand, set at the intersection of Emirates Road (E611) and Hessa Street (D61). It comprises 56 low-rise buildings across two clusters — Al Thamam, handed over in 2013, and Al Ramth, which has continued to deliver buildings — offering affordable studios to three-bedroom apartments amid extensive parkland. Amenities include resort-style swimming pools, a gymnasium, basketball, volleyball and tennis courts, children's playgrounds, BBQ areas, a retail centre, nursery and school, a mosque and community centre, landscaped parks and pedestrian paths, with covered parking. The community sits opposite Mudon and Golf City, near Arabian Ranches, Trump International Golf Club and Dubai Autodrome.

Location and Connectivity

Remraam lies in Dubailand off Emirates Road, between the Jebel Ali area and Al Maktoum International Airport, with Sheikh Zayed Road and Global Village within easy reach.
